I prefer the "high" regen breaking setting when driving as then I have complete 1-pedal driving control (I almost never hit the brakes) while my partner prefers the "normal" setting as he finds high to be too herky-jerky.

I thought this setting was tied to a profile, but it doesn't save nor update when we switch profiles. Am I mistaken thinking this setting was associated with a profile, or is it a bug?

I wish it was associated with a profile but it is not.
 
My non-Lucid EV also doesn’t do this. Could be a safely thing.
 
At least the regeneration setting stays on between drives. I’m a little bummed that drive style resets to Smooth on each start.

It reverts to Smooth but the regen setting stays where it was from the last drive.
